The Jaipuri Cotton Kurti is a traditional ethnic garment meticulously crafted from high-quality cotton fabric sourced from Jaipur, Rajasthan. Renowned for its breathable and lightweight nature, this kurti ensures all-day comfort, making it ideal for warm climates and daily wear. Characterized by its exquisite block print patterns and vibrant colors, each kurti reflects the rich heritage of Jaipur's craftsmanship. Perfectly tailored with attention to detail, it features a flattering silhouette suited for diverse body types.
